Ethyl 12-fluorododecanoate

ADVERTISEMENT
Identification
Molecular formula
C14H27FO2
CAS number
56712-56-6
IUPAC name
ethyl 12-fluorododecanoate
State
State

At room temperature, ethyl 12-fluorododecanoate is in a liquid state.

Comment on solubility

Solubility of Ethyl 12-Fluorododecanoate

Ethyl 12-fluorododecanoate, with the chemical formula C14H27F O2, exhibits interesting solubility properties that are influenced by the structure of the molecule. Here are some key points to consider:

  • Polar vs Nonpolar: The presence of the fluorine atom introduces polarity to the molecule, which may enhance its solubility in polar solvents like alcohols and ether.
  • Hydrophobic Characteristics: With a long hydrocarbon chain, ethyl 12-fluorododecanoate is also likely to display hydrophobic characteristics, which can limit its solubility in water.
  • Solvent Compatibility: It is generally expected to be soluble in organic solvents such as hexane and chloroform, which can solvate long-chain fatty esters.
  • Temperature Influence: Like many compounds, its solubility can be temperature-dependent; solubility may increase at elevated temperatures.

In summary, while ethyl 12-fluorododecanoate may present solubility in polar solvents due to the presence of the fluorine atom, its long carbon chain promotes hydrophobic interactions, creating a complex interplay that can impact its overall solubility profile. As with many organics, consideration of solvent type is key when determining its solubility behavior.
